The Six Bases<br />

Basis is that where consciousness generates, arises, develops, or that whereupon it<br />

depends.<br />

68. The eye-basis is the element of the sensorium within the eye- ball where consciousness of<br />

sight is generated; and the consciousness of sight connotes the power of seeing various<br />

kinds of colours, appearances, forms and shapes.<br />

69. The ear-basis is the element of the sensorium within the organ of the ear where<br />

consciousness of sound is generated, and the consciousness of sound connotes the power<br />

of hearing various kinds of sound.<br />

70. The nose-basis is the element of the sensorium within the nose organ where consciousness<br />

of smell is generated, and the consciousness of smell connotes the power of smelling<br />

different kinds of odours.<br />

71. The tongue-basis is the element of the sensorium upon the surface of the tongue where<br />

consciousness of taste is generated, and the consciousness of taste connotes the power of<br />

tasting many kinds such as sweet, sour, and so forth.<br />

72. The body-basis is the element of the sensorium locating itself by pervading the whole<br />

body within and without from head to foot, where consciousness of touch is generated,<br />

and the consciousness of touch connotes the power of feeling or sensing physical contacts.<br />

73. The heart-basis a kind of very fine, bright, subtle matter within the organ of heart where<br />

mind consciousness, <strong>com</strong>prising sixty- nine classes of the same in number is generated.<br />

From these six bases all classes of consciousness are generated and arise.<br />

The Two Bhavas or Sexes<br />

Bhava means production or productive principle.<br />

74. The Itthi-bhava or the female sex is a certain productive principle of matter which<br />

produces several different kinds of female appearances and feminine characters.<br />

75. The Pum-bhava or the male sex is a certain productive principle of matter which produces<br />

several different kinds of male appearances and masculine characters.<br />

The two sexes respectively locate themselves in the bodies of male and female, like the<br />

body-basis pervading the entire frame, from the sole of the foot to the top of the head<br />

within and without. Owing to their predominant features the distinction between<br />

masculinity and feminity is readily discerned.
